Anteckning
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
Gäller för:SQL Server
När du installerar SQL Server Database Engine beror de verktyg som installeras på utgåvan och dina konfigurationsalternativ. Den här lektionen beskriver huvudverktygen och visar hur du ansluter till databasmotorn och utför en viktig funktion (auktoriserar fler användare).
I den här lektionen lär du dig följande:
Verktyg för att komma igång
SQL Server Database Engine levereras med olika verktyg. Den här artikeln beskriver de första verktygen du behöver och hjälper dig att välja rätt verktyg för ett jobb. Alla verktyg kan nås från Start-menyn . Vissa verktyg, till exempel SQL Server Management Studio (SSMS) installeras inte som standard. Välj de verktyg som du vill använda som komponenter under installationen. SQL Server Express innehåller bara en delmängd av verktygen.
Vanliga verktyg
I följande tabell beskrivs några av de vanligaste verktygen.
| Tool | Typ | Operativsystem |
|---|---|---|
| SSMS | GUI | Windows |
| Azure Data Studio | GUI | Windows, macOS, Linux |
| Bcp | Kommandoradsgränssnitt (CLI) | Windows, macOS, Linux |
| sqlcmd | Kommandoradsgränssnitt (CLI) | Windows, macOS, Linux |
Den här artikeln fokuserar på att ansluta via SSMS. Om du är intresserad av att ansluta via Azure Data Studio kan du läsa Snabbstart: Använda Azure Data Studio för att ansluta och fråga SQL Server.
Exempeldatabas
Kodexemplen i den här artikeln använder AdventureWorks2022- eller AdventureWorksDW2022-exempeldatabasen, som du kan ladda ned från startsidan Microsoft SQL Server Samples och Community Projects.
SSMS (endast Windows)
- På aktuella versioner av Windows går du till sidan Start , anger SSMS och väljer sedan SQL Server Management Studio.
- På Start-menyn i äldre versioner av Windows pekar du på Alla program, pekar på Microsoft SQL Server och väljer sedan SQL Server Management Studio.
Ansluta med SSMS
Det är enkelt att ansluta till databasmotorn från verktyg som körs på samma dator som är värd för SQL Server om du känner till namnet på instansen och om du ansluter som medlem i den lokala gruppen Administratörer på datorn. Följande procedurer måste utföras på samma dator som är värd för SQL Server.
Anmärkning
I den här artikeln beskrivs hur du ansluter till en lokal SQL Server. Information om Azure SQL Database finns i Ansluta till Azure SQL Database.
Fastställa namnet på instansen av databasmotorn
Logga in på Windows som medlem i gruppen Administratörer och öppna Management Studio.
I dialogrutan Anslut till server väljer du Avbryt.
Om Registrerade servrar inte visas går du till menyn Visa och väljer Registrerade servrar.
Med Databasmotorn markerad i verktygsfältet Registrerade servrar expanderar du Databasmotor, högerklickar på Lokala servergrupper, pekar på Uppgifter och väljer sedan Registrera lokala servrar. Expandera Lokala servergrupper för att se alla instanser av databasmotorn installerade på datorn. Standardinstansen är namnlös och visas som datornamn. En namngiven instans visas som datornamnet följt av ett bakåtsnedstreck (\) och sedan instansens namn. För SQL Server Express heter <instansen computer_name>\sqlexpress om inte namnet ändrades under installationen.
Kontrollera att databasmotorn körs
Om namnet på din instans av SQL Server i Registrerade servrar har en grön punkt med en vit pil bredvid namnet, körs databasmotorn och ingen ytterligare åtgärd krävs.
Om namnet på din instans av SQL Server har en röd punkt med en vit fyrkant bredvid namnet stoppas databasmotorn. Högerklicka på namnet på databasmotorn, välj Tjänstkontroll och välj sedan Starta. Efter en bekräftelsedialogruta bör databasmotorn starta och cirkeln ska bli grön med en vit pil.
Ansluta till databasmotorn
Minst ett administratörskonto valdes när SQL Server installerades. Utför följande steg när du är inloggad i Windows som administratör.
I Management Studio går du till Arkiv-menyn och väljer Anslut Objektutforskaren.
Dialogrutan Anslut till server öppnas. Rutan Servertyp visar den typ av komponent som senast användes.
Välj Databasmotor.
I rutan Servernamn anger du namnet på instansen av databasmotorn. För standardinstansen av SQL Server är servernamnet datornamnet. Servernamnet för en namngiven instans av SQL Server är <computer_name>\<instance_name>. Till exempel ACCTG_SRVR\SQLEXPRESS. Följande skärmbild visar alternativen för att ansluta till sql Server-standardinstansen (namnlös) på en dator med namnet
PracticeComputer. Användaren som är inloggad i Windows är Mary från Contoso-domänen. När du använder Windows-autentisering kan du inte ändra användarnamnet.Välj Anslut.
Anmärkning
Den här artikeln är skriven med antagandet att du är nybörjare på SQL Server och inte har några problem med att ansluta. Detaljerade felsökningssteg finns i Felsöka anslutning till SQL Server Database Engine.
Auktorisera extra anslutningar
Nu när du är ansluten till SQL Server som administratör är en av dina första uppgifter att ge andra användare behörighet att ansluta. Du auktoriserar användare genom att skapa en inloggning och auktorisera inloggningen för att få åtkomst till en databas som en användare. Du kan skapa inloggningar med hjälp av Windows-autentisering, SQL Server-autentisering eller Microsoft Entra-autentisering. Windows-autentiseringsinloggningar använder autentiseringsuppgifter från Windows. SQL Server-autentiseringsinloggningar lagrar autentiseringsinformationen i SQL Server och är oberoende av dina Windows-autentiseringsuppgifter. Inloggningar från Microsoft Entra-ID (tidigare Azure Active Directory) använder autentiseringsuppgifter från molnbaserade identiteter. Mer information om den här metoden finns i Microsoft Entra-autentisering för SQL Server
Använd Windows-autentisering eller Microsoft Entra-autentisering när det är möjligt.
Tips/Råd
De flesta organisationer har domänanvändare och använder Windows-autentisering. Du kan experimentera genom att skapa ytterligare lokala användare på datorn. Datorn autentiserar lokala användare, så domänen är datornamnet. Om datorn till exempel heter MyComputer och du skapar en användare med namnet Testär Mycomputer\TestWindows-beskrivningen för användaren .
Skapa en Windows-autentiseringsinloggning
I föregående uppgift anslöt du till databasmotorn med hjälp av Management Studio. Expandera serverinstansen i Object Explorer, expandera Säkerhet, högerklicka på Inloggningar och välj sedan Ny inloggning. Dialogrutan Logga in – ny visas.
På sidan Allmänt i rutan Inloggningsnamn anger du en Windows-inloggning i formatet
<domain>\<login>.
I rutan Standarddatabas väljer du Databasen AdventureWorks om den är tillgänglig. Annars väljer du
masterdatabasen.På sidan Serverroller väljer du sysadmin om den nya inloggningen ska vara administratör. Annars lämnar du det här tomt.
På sidan Användarmappning väljer du Mappa för databasen
AdventureWorks2022om den är tillgänglig. Annars väljer dumaster. Rutan Användare fylls i med inloggningen. När dialogrutan stängs skapas användaren i databasen.I rutan Standardschema anger du dbo för att mappa inloggningen till databasens ägarschema.
Acceptera standardinställningarna för rutorna Securables och Status och välj sedan OK för att skapa inloggningen.
Viktigt!
Det här avsnittet innehåller grundläggande information för att komma igång. SQL Server tillhandahåller en omfattande säkerhetsmiljö.
Relaterade uppgifter
- Anslut till databasmotorn
- Felsöka anslutning till SQL Server Database Engine
- Snabbstart: Ansluta och fråga en Azure SQL Database eller en Hanterad Azure SQL-instans med hjälp av SSMS
- Snabbstart: Använda Azure Data Studio för att ansluta och köra frågor mot SQL Server